Madonna facing legal action after MDNA show in Paris

By Tribute on July 16, 2012 | 5 Comments


No stranger to controversy, 53-year-old Madonna decided to flash both her entire breast and her thong to her Paris audience this past Saturday. Shockingly enough though, this is not what has put the singer in hot water. Instead, it was her decision to repeat her actions from her Tel Aviv concert by exhibiting a photo of National Front right-wing political party leader Marine Le Pen, with a swastika on her forehead. Madonna showed she is not afraid to get political in a Sinead O’Conner-esque act of protest against the organization, which has been rumored to be associated with anti-Semitism.

A source from the National Front previously told the Daily Mail, “We are not a Nazi party, and object to being depicted as such. If you accuse the National Front of being anti-Semitic and racist then you accuse a fifth of the French people of being anti-Semitic and racist.” ~Morgan Bates
